WebThe job role of an administrator involves the following duties: Preparing, organising and storing information in paper and digital form Dealing with queries on the phone and by email Greeting visitors at reception Managing diaries, scheduling meetings and booking rooms Arranging travel and accommodation Arranging post and deliveries Web19 Oct 2024 · A business-related degree can also help as it shows you understand business objectives and environments. In terms of progression, it’s common for a BDE to be promoted to BDM (Business Development Manager). Moving into this role is likely to involve taking on more responsibility for the planning and development of the company’s growth strategy.
